Definición
Areas of land behind people's houses, usually used for relaxing, gardening, or playing.
Uso & Matices
'Backyards' is plural and used for multiple houses. Often associated with suburban life and family activities. In US English, 'backyard' is common, while in UK English, 'garden' is often used instead.
